Greg Doran, former artistic director of the Royal Shakespeare Company, has undertaken an extraordinary global pilgrimage following the death of his husband, Antony Sher. The book intertwines Sher's candid "Dying Diaries" from his final six months battling liver cancer with Doran's own quest to locate over 200 existing copies of Shakespeare's First Folio. These diaries reveal Sher's characteristic resilience, wit, and unwavering love, even as he confronted his mortality.
Doran's journey, initiated around the 2023 quatercentenary of the First Folio's publication, began in Britain and extended across North America, Japan, South Africa, and Australia. This "Folio Roadshow" is described by Doran himself as a "massive piece of displacement activity," a way to cope with grief and find a new purpose. He engages with the rich history of each Folio, encountering eccentric collectors and even forgers.
